Grammarly Text Editor SDK for React
Add Grammarly's real-time writing support to your app with just a few lines of code.

This package is designed for React apps. Visit @grammarly/editor-sdk for our package for vanilla JavaScript apps and @grammarly/editor-sdk-vue for our package for Vue apps.
Getting started
Here's how to get started:
-
Create a new Grammarly for Developers app
-
Install the Grammarly Text Editor SDK:
npm install @grammarly/editor-sdk-react
-
Add the Grammarly Text Editor Plugin to your text editors by wrapping them with the GrammarlyEditorPlugin component:
import React from "react";
import { GrammarlyEditorPlugin } from "@grammarly/editor-sdk-react";
export function GrammarlyEditor() {
return (
<GrammarlyEditorPlugin clientId="YOUR_CLIENT_ID">
<textarea></textarea>
</GrammarlyEditorPlugin>
);
}
